The Longing for Lost Love
Luiz Carlos Magno's song "Você Tem Que Voltar" is a poignant exploration of longing and heartache following a sudden separation. The lyrics open with the singer waking up in tears, overwhelmed by the absence of a loved one. This emotional turmoil is compounded by a dream where the singer briefly reunites with their partner, only to be jolted back to the painful reality of their absence. The song captures the confusion and disbelief that often accompany unexpected breakups, as the singer struggles to comprehend the reasons behind their partner's departure.
The lyrics convey a deep sense of denial and refusal to accept the separation. The singer insists that everything was going well, and thus, the breakup seems unfounded and unjust. This sentiment is a common theme in songs about lost love, where the abrupt end of a relationship leaves one partner grappling with unanswered questions and unresolved feelings. The repeated plea for the partner to return underscores the singer's desperation and hope that reconciliation will restore happiness.
Additionally, the song hints at external influences that may have contributed to the breakup. The singer suggests that someone else, through deceit, played a role in ending the relationship. This introduces a layer of betrayal and manipulation, adding complexity to the narrative. The insistence that the partner "has to return" reflects a belief that their reunion is the key to restoring balance and joy in the singer's life. Through its heartfelt lyrics, "Você Tem Que Voltar" captures the universal experience of yearning for a lost love and the hope for a second chance.
